The Hindi-dubbed version of (1994) serves as a fascinating intersection of American slapstick and Indian linguistic flair. Originally the film that propelled Jim Carrey to global superstardom, its Hindi adaptation helped cement his status as a household name in India, where his high-energy "rubber-faced" comedy style found a natural home alongside the physical comedy traditions of Bollywood. As Ace Ventura—a goofy, Hawaiian-shirt-wearing private investigator specializing in the retrieval of missing animals—Carrey turned what could have been a standard B-movie plot into a box-office juggernaut. When Snowflake, the aquatic mascot of the Miami Dolphins, is kidnapped just two weeks before the Super Bowl, Ace is called in to solve the case. The plot is simple, but the execution relies entirely on Carrey’s unhinged charisma. Why the Hindi Dubbed Version is a Cult Phenomenon
Dubbing a Jim Carrey movie into Hindi is an immense challenge. Carrey relies heavily on fast-paced English wordplay, exaggerated facial expressions, and culturally specific American references. The Hindi dubbing team succeeded by reimagining the script rather than translating it literally. 1. Adaptation of Slang and Punchlines
